9


i finally got to take alanna to see the movie "9" today. we both really wanted to see it last week on 9/9/09 when it opened, but our schedule that day just didn't allow it. better late than never. we both really liked it! it was a little scary and at times pretty intense for being a completely animated feature. the visuals were awesome. and i even cried a little. but i cry a little during almost every movie, so that isn't saying much, haha. the story was predictable, but i thought it was sad and cute, in a dark and creepy sort of way. totally my kind of movie. and the music was done by danny elfman, which is a plus. i would not recommend this for younger kids. alanna is almost 13 and has grown up around my liking of all things creepy (remember i love tim burton, who co-produced this film, and also the nightmare before christmas, etc.) so she appreciated it as much as i did. if you like those kinds of things as well, be sure to see this movie before it leaves the theaters.

"life is mysterious and amazing"

yesterday alanna and i went to see ponyo


it was really cute. if you've seen any of hayao miyazaki's other animated films, then you will probably enjoy this one too. it was a little more americanized, and maybe geared more for younger children, but we still liked it a lot. alanna loves his other movies. especially spirited away, howl's moving castle, and princess mononoke. if you haven't seen any of these, you should check them out. he is very imaginative, and his films are strange and creative and pretty interesting.
